flatline01
10-13-2006, 04:27 PM
for the portrait, i think the shoulders are turned a bit too much. and as a presumed military man, the hair cut seems a bit longish. Proportions are good, value is good. contrast can probably be pushed a little. the light source is ok, again needs to be pushed a little bit. as a portrait, i think it can keep going, but as concept piece, it shows a good sense of charecter and mood.
overall, pretty good.
for the scene, the lighting is really good, and i feel the desperation on the upper half of the body. the legs seem a bit dangly, and not as dynamic as the rest of the figure. the hatches are nice, and the perspective is good. the blue values work well, and i like the red-purple highlights.
keep going on both!

Conkrys
10-19-2006, 11:09 AM
Wow! I didn't expect a comment from the President of CGSociety! hehe. Thanks for visiting and do visit again! ;) It was very hard for me to make the model in real size... Max seems to not like working with kilometers. So I worked with mm. 1mm = 1m. It made it easier to work with the lighting and stuff. I just don't know how I'm gonna handle it comming down to the details since a human is about 1,7 mm. Anyway glad you dropped by.
Gonzalo Golpe: Thanx for the comments. yeah the angle is pretty dull. I am working on a new angle... probably one from down low near the complex looking up toward the towerring Cap.
